Ledger’s introduction of a multisignature interface comes with a price tag—specifically, a flat fee of $10 per transaction and a 0.05% charge on token transfers. This move has sent ripples of discontent through an ecosystem that prides itself on decentralization and low barriers to entry. What was once a calm expanse has transformed into a churning sea of discontent, as members of the crypto community grapple with the implications of this shift. The justification of these fees rests on the maintenance of advanced security features, but does that rationale hold water in a realm designed to eschew intermediaries and exorbitant costs?
